Katy picked up the medicine, shielding the herbal concoction with her umbrella as she hurried home.

She made her way back to the old neighborhood, threading through narrow alleys, and slipped into a weathered, cramped apartment.

The space was barely a hundred square feet, divided in half by a faded curtain. Katy tiptoed behind the curtain.

Yara lay on a narrow, child-sized bed, her face ghostly pale, still unconscious. Katy crept closer and carefully felt for her mother's breath.

Relieved to find Yara was still alive, Katy clumsily wiped the rainwater from her cheeks and set about preparing the medicine.

Her movements were practiced-she'd clearly done this many times before.

Yara, awakened by the sounds, slowly opened her eyes. She saw Katy's small back facing her, tending the old saucepan over the stove, fanning the flames. Katy was five, but looked even younger, painfully thin for her age.

Yara's eyes filled with tears.

She had once believed she could give Katy a good life, protect her from harm.

But she hadn't expected Blake to blacklist her.

What little savings she had left vanished faster than she'd imagined—especially when she fell ill so suddenly.

"Mommy, you're awake!"

Katy noticed Yara stirring and dashed to her bedside, her tiny hand checking Yara's forehead. "How do you feel, Mommy? I'm making your medicine-once you drink it, you'll feel better."

"Katy, where did you get the money?"

Yara hadn't been able to work as a designer since she got sick. Just as she'd planned to pick up some odd jobs, she started coughing blood.
